Don't pin `@veldt/ui-core` to a patch version here. Our convention at Brindlework is caret ranges for the shared library, strict pins only for forks. Mixing the two is what broke the Quillhaven release last month. Also, bump the peer dependency when you touch button variants. The resolver fallbacks below govern how version conflicts get settled; these are the current values.

limits module of kawef-hawef:
TIERS = {
    "belax": 967,
    "gorvan": 210,
    "ulair": 473,
}

### Runbook fragment: Fuelgrid weekly report

For the eng sync: the Fuelgrid fleet fuel-usage report job authenticates to the telemetry warehouse using a service secret stored in the job's env file. If the Monday run fails with an auth error, verify that file first. The required secret entry should appear on the line immediately following this sentence.

vault entry, kafog-yahop: COURIER_KEY8=0faa53ae

- [ ] **FD leak audit (Corvette proxy, release 5.9):** Confirm the leaked-file-descriptor hunt is closed out. Root cause was the Glimmerport TLS shim failing to close sockets on handshake timeout; under load the proxy exhausted its descriptor table within hours. The fix adds deterministic cleanup plus a soft-limit alarm at 80% utilization. Security review should confirm no descriptors are inherited by the sandboxed worker children after fork. Soak test ran 48 hours clean on the candidate identified by the token below.

build token for yajof-bajof: htk31_506ff1188f74596b5bb2eec94edc43c

Subject: Revised Commission Scheme — Effective Next Quarter

Team,

As discussed at the Ferndale offsite, we are moving from flat-rate commissions to a tiered structure tied to margin rather than gross bookings. Deals on the Altavine line earn an accelerator above 110% of quota; renewals shift to a reduced rate after year two. Calculators and FAQ sheets go out to all sales leads Monday. Payroll timing is unchanged. Please review the tables before cascading to your teams. The rationale ties into our plans outlined below.

confidential, kagup-bafog: Fraaxax Group is in early talks to buy Soroxox Group for about $343.8 million. The Olidor launch date is June 14, and nothing goes to the press before then. Legal wants the Aldmirek Logistics term sheet signed before July 23.